The Space Merchants by Frederik Pohl (w/CM Kornbluth):
Science Fiction Inventions, Technology and Ideas

Exceptional novel; it's focus on marketing and advertising will make you scratch your head and realize that there was someone who thought about our world that is packed tight with advertising - in 1950! Select an invention:
